Sadly my getting home was not much fun tonight, had a little incident with a pedestrian on Haymarket. I had a guy decide to walk out onto the road as I was approaching so I slowed down and he halted on the other side of the road... as I got closer he changed his mind and decided to run for it across my path, I hit the brakes and the guy makes contact with my right hand wing-mirror (and indicator judging by what's left), bike goes down. Luckily 3 coppers saw all the action and run over. After making sure I was OK, they quickly assure me they saw the whole thing and that there was nothing I could have done. After being checked over by an ambulance crew they have to take a statement from me just in case the idiot decides to make a complaint later about me. Apparently pedestrians cannot be held responsible for running out in-front of vehicles and in fact by law I am responsible for his idiocy!!!!

Luckily if the guy does make a complaint I have three coppers and my mate who was following me to give witness to the fact that I did nothing wrong.
